There are a number of options to improve the A-2 crossing with a range of costs and benefits. Today, A-2 is like two interstate highways meeting at a stoplight. Future O’Hare express and high-speed trains will pass through A-2 as well. Illinois and Wisconsin are planning for more Amtrak trains to Milwaukee. The crossing is destined to become much busier. Over 51,000 daily passengers on seven of Metra’s eleven routes and another 3,700 on Amtrak rely on A-2 working smoothly, but the track layout and switching equipment are over eighty years old, and replacement parts are hard to find. It is one of the busiest and most complicated rail intersections in North America with 350 trains crossing paths here every day. and Kinzie St., A-2 is where Union Pacific-owned tracks from Ogilvie Transportation Center cross Metra-owned tracks from Union Station. The flag was designed by Amiruddin Kidwai, and is based on the All-India Muslim League flag. Though the green color is mandated only as 'dark green', its official and most consistent representation is Pakistan green, which is shaded distinctively darker. The flag is a green field with a white crescent moon and five-rayed star at its center, and a vertical white stripe at the hoist side. It was afterwards retained by the current-day Islamic Republic of Pakistan. The national flag of Pakistan (Urdu: پاکستان کا قومی پرچم) was adopted in its present form during a meeting of the Constituent Assembly on August 11, 1947, just three days before the country's independence, when it became the official flag of the Dominion of Pakistan. The National Anthem was first played properly on Radio Pakistan on August 13, 1954. The anthem lasts for 1 minute and 20 seconds, and uses twenty one musical instruments and thirty eight different tones. Every word in the entire anthem is a loanword from Persian except the word "ka" ( کا, "of" ). The lyrics are written in a highly Persian form of Urdu. ![]() The music composed by Chagla reflects his background in both eastern and western music. However, the music for the anthem had been composed in 1950 and had been used on several occasions before official adoption. ![]() The three stanza composition was officially adopted in 1954. The music of the anthem was composed by Ahmed Ghulamali Chagla, with lyrics written by Abu-Al-Asar Hafeez Jullundhri. The Pakistani national anthem is unique in that its music preceded its lyrics. The words "Qaumi Tarana" in Urdu literally translate to "National Anthem". The Qaumi Tarana is the National Anthem of Pakistan.
